Barbie fashion designers and collectors, known for their many years of working with Mattel, have tragically killed with two other people in an accident on Turin -Milan Highway.
On Sunday, July 27, a deadly accident occurred in Turin – Milan Highway in Italy, which killed famous designers of Kukok Barbie – Mario Pulino and Gianni Grossy, who are also life partners.
According to Out Magazine, an 82 -year -old driver was urged to move 7 kilometers in the upcoming road in the wrong direction. As a result of a frontal clash, everyone died: a pensioner, both designers and their passengers.
The Pino and Grossy in 1999 established the Magia 2000 brand, which specializes in the unique design of dolls. Over the years, they have created twelve exclusive models in collaboration with Mattel, especially in respect of the stars such as Lady Gaga, Cher, Victoria Beckham, Sarah Jessica Parker and Madonna.
Mattel expressed deep regrets for losing by publishing a memorable post on Instagram:
“The Barbie team was killed by the loss of Mario Pagrino and Gianni Grossy-Two important creators and Mattel officials who brought joy and art to the Barbie world. They were enthusiastic, talented designers and collectors, and their spirit and love for the brand open every creation where they were held, their goodwill they created.
